2. Uhum and Ugari
Uhum means law, while Ugari means custom. For the Batak people, the law must be
enforced fairly. Justice can be realized if people make a habit of remaining faithful to their
promises. If you renege on an agreement, according to Batak customs in the past, the person will
receive customary sanctions. People who violate the agreement will be considered despicable.
Therefore, Uhum and Ugari are very important in the life of the Batak people.
3. Hamoraon
Hamoraon is a cultural value that means honor. The honor in question is a balance between
material and spiritual. One must have both of these things, for example wealth and a kind attitude
towards others, then one is considered to have perfect honor. If only one, then it is incomplete and
has not reached Hamoraan.
4. Shelter
Protection has the meaning as a protector or protector. The life philosophy of protection
teaches that every individual can be a protector for those around him. Therefore, the Batak people
are taught not to depend on others. This value teaches that the Batak people should live
independently and not always rely on others.
5. Marsisarian
Marsisarian is the value to maintain the balance of human relations. Every human being is
a different individual, so in social life, the values of Marsisarian are very necessary so that human
beings can live side by side in harmony, even though there are many differences between them.
Marsisarian values teach the Batak people to help, understand, and respect each other. That way
they will respect each other, so that conflict can be avoided.
6. Kinship
The last value is one of the characteristics of the Batak tribe which is very important in
their lives. Currently, we can see good kinship between the sub-tribes of the Batak community.
Good kinship can be realized through 3 things, namely family ties through marriage, good speech
between people, and Martarombo.
Martarombo means looking for relatives. This is especially true for the Batak tribe who are
wandering. Usually they will look for fellow Batak tribes or those who have the same residents in
their overseas places. The aim is to establish good relations between clans even though they are
overseas.
